This is an automated email from the ASF dual-hosted git repository.

rombert pushed a commit to annotated tag 
org.apache.sling.testing.sling-mock-2.0.0
in repository 
https://gitbox.apache.org/repos/asf/sling-org-apache-sling-testing-sling-mock.git

commit 41b471d6363447255198366b88b2b19d38384697
Author: Stefan Seifert <[email protected]>
AuthorDate: Tue Feb 23 00:33:26 2016 +0000

    SLING-5546 remove deprecated methods
    
    git-svn-id: 
https://svn.apache.org/repos/asf/sling/trunk/testing/mocks/sling-mock@1731765 
13f79535-47bb-0310-9956-ffa450edef68
---
 .../apache/sling/testing/mock/sling/MockSling.java | 67 ----------------------
 .../sling/testing/mock/sling/package-info.java     |  2 +-
 .../sling/servlet/MockSlingHttpServletRequest.java | 23 +-------
 .../testing/mock/sling/servlet/package-info.java   |  2 +-
 4 files changed, 3 insertions(+), 91 deletions(-)

diff --git a/src/main/java/org/apache/sling/testing/mock/sling/MockSling.java 
b/src/main/java/org/apache/sling/testing/mock/sling/MockSling.java
index b53faae..fdc222e 100644
--- a/src/main/java/org/apache/sling/testing/mock/sling/MockSling.java
+++ b/src/main/java/org/apache/sling/testing/mock/sling/MockSling.java
@@ -26,7 +26,6 @@ import org.apache.sling.api.resource.ResourceResolver;
 import org.apache.sling.api.resource.ResourceResolverFactory;
 import org.apache.sling.api.scripting.SlingScriptHelper;
 import org.apache.sling.jcr.api.SlingRepository;
-import org.apache.sling.testing.mock.osgi.MockOsgi;
 import org.apache.sling.testing.mock.sling.servlet.MockSlingHttpServletRequest;
 import 
org.apache.sling.testing.mock.sling.servlet.MockSlingHttpServletResponse;
 import org.apache.sling.testing.mock.sling.spi.ResourceResolverTypeAdapter;
@@ -54,18 +53,6 @@ public final class MockSling {
 
     /**
      * Creates new sling resource resolver factory instance.
-     * @param type Type of underlying repository.
-     * @return Resource resolver factory instance
-     * @deprecated Please use {@link 
#newResourceResolverFactory(ResourceResolverType, BundleContext)}
-     *   and shutdown the bundle context after usage.
-     */
-    @Deprecated
-    public static ResourceResolverFactory newResourceResolverFactory(final 
ResourceResolverType type) {
-        return newResourceResolverFactory(type, MockOsgi.newBundleContext());
-    }
-    
-    /**
-     * Creates new sling resource resolver factory instance.
      * @param bundleContext Bundle context
      * @return Resource resolver factory instance
      */
@@ -119,47 +106,6 @@ public final class MockSling {
     }
 
     /**
-     * Creates new sling resource resolver factory instance using
-     * {@link #DEFAULT_RESOURCERESOLVER_TYPE}.
-     * @return Resource resolver factory instance
-     * @deprecated Please use {@link 
#newResourceResolverFactory(BundleContext)}
-     *   and shutdown the bundle context after usage.
-     */
-    @Deprecated
-    public static ResourceResolverFactory newResourceResolverFactory() {
-        return newResourceResolverFactory(DEFAULT_RESOURCERESOLVER_TYPE);
-    }
-
-    /**
-     * Creates new sling resource resolver instance.
-     * @param type Type of underlying repository.
-     * @return Resource resolver instance
-     * @deprecated Please use {@link 
#newResourceResolver(ResourceResolverType, BundleContext)}
-     *   and shutdown the bundle context after usage.
-     */
-    @Deprecated
-    public static ResourceResolver newResourceResolver(final 
ResourceResolverType type) {
-        ResourceResolverFactory factory = newResourceResolverFactory(type);
-        try {
-            return factory.getAdministrativeResourceResolver(null);
-        } catch (LoginException ex) {
-            throw new RuntimeException("Mock resource resolver factory 
implementation seems to require login.", ex);
-        }
-    }
-
-    /**
-     * Creates new sling resource resolver instance using
-     * {@link #DEFAULT_RESOURCERESOLVER_TYPE}.
-     * @return Resource resolver instance
-     * @deprecated Please use {@link #newResourceResolver(BundleContext)}
-     *   and shutdown the bundle context after usage.
-     */
-    @Deprecated
-    public static ResourceResolver newResourceResolver() {
-        return newResourceResolver(DEFAULT_RESOURCERESOLVER_TYPE);
-    }
-
-    /**
      * Creates new sling resource resolver instance.
      * @param type Type of underlying repository.
      * @param bundleContext Bundle context
@@ -199,19 +145,6 @@ public final class MockSling {
     /**
      * Creates a new sling script helper instance using
      * {@link #DEFAULT_RESOURCERESOLVER_TYPE} for the resource resolver.
-     * @return Sling script helper instance
-     * @deprecated Please use {@link #newSlingScriptHelper(BundleContext)}
-     *   and shutdown the bundle context after usage.
-     */
-    @Deprecated
-    public static SlingScriptHelper newSlingScriptHelper() {
-        BundleContext bundleContext = MockOsgi.newBundleContext();
-        return newSlingScriptHelper(bundleContext);
-    }
-
-    /**
-     * Creates a new sling script helper instance using
-     * {@link #DEFAULT_RESOURCERESOLVER_TYPE} for the resource resolver.
      * @param bundleContext Bundle context
      * @return Sling script helper instance
      */
diff --git 
a/src/main/java/org/apache/sling/testing/mock/sling/package-info.java 
b/src/main/java/org/apache/sling/testing/mock/sling/package-info.java
index b34a57d..a0c9444 100644
--- a/src/main/java/org/apache/sling/testing/mock/sling/package-info.java
+++ b/src/main/java/org/apache/sling/testing/mock/sling/package-info.java
@@ -19,5 +19,5 @@
 /**
  * Mock implementation of selected Sling APIs.
  */
[email protected]("1.6")
[email protected]("2.0")
 package org.apache.sling.testing.mock.sling;
diff --git 
a/src/main/java/org/apache/sling/testing/mock/sling/servlet/MockSlingHttpServletRequest.java
 
b/src/main/java/org/apache/sling/testing/mock/sling/servlet/MockSlingHttpServletRequest.java
index dc251c5..798ad02 100644
--- 
a/src/main/java/org/apache/sling/testing/mock/sling/servlet/MockSlingHttpServletRequest.java
+++ 
b/src/main/java/org/apache/sling/testing/mock/sling/servlet/MockSlingHttpServletRequest.java
@@ -23,7 +23,6 @@ import java.util.ResourceBundle;
 
 import org.apache.sling.api.resource.ResourceResolver;
 import org.apache.sling.i18n.ResourceBundleProvider;
-import org.apache.sling.testing.mock.osgi.MockOsgi;
 import org.apache.sling.testing.mock.sling.MockSling;
 import org.osgi.framework.BundleContext;
 import org.osgi.framework.ServiceReference;
@@ -37,30 +36,10 @@ public class MockSlingHttpServletRequest extends 
org.apache.sling.servlethelpers
 
     /**
      * Instantiate with default resource resolver
-     * @deprecated Please use {@link 
#MockSlingHttpServletRequest(BundleContext)}
-     *   and shutdown the bundle context after usage.
-     */
-    @Deprecated
-    public MockSlingHttpServletRequest() {
-        this(MockOsgi.newBundleContext());
-    }
-
-    /**
-     * Instantiate with default resource resolver
      * @param bundleContext Bundle context
      */
     public MockSlingHttpServletRequest(BundleContext bundleContext) {
-        this(MockSling.newResourceResolver(bundleContext));
-    }
-
-    /**
-     * @param resourceResolver Resource resolver
-     * @deprecated Please use {@link 
#MockSlingHttpServletRequest(ResourceResolver, BundleContext)}
-     *   and shutdown the bundle context after usage.
-     */
-    @Deprecated
-    public MockSlingHttpServletRequest(ResourceResolver resourceResolver) {
-        this(resourceResolver, MockOsgi.newBundleContext());
+        this(MockSling.newResourceResolver(bundleContext), bundleContext);
     }
 
     /**
diff --git 
a/src/main/java/org/apache/sling/testing/mock/sling/servlet/package-info.java 
b/src/main/java/org/apache/sling/testing/mock/sling/servlet/package-info.java
index 0408710..67c2cbd 100644
--- 
a/src/main/java/org/apache/sling/testing/mock/sling/servlet/package-info.java
+++ 
b/src/main/java/org/apache/sling/testing/mock/sling/servlet/package-info.java
@@ -19,5 +19,5 @@
 /**
  * Mock implementation of selected Servlet-related Sling APIs.
  */
[email protected]("2.0")
[email protected]("3.0")
 package org.apache.sling.testing.mock.sling.servlet;

-- 
To stop receiving notification emails like this one, please contact
"[email protected]" <[email protected]>.

Reply via email to